Aberystwyth Arts Centre is an award winning and leading hub for culture, creativity and entertainment, serving as a leading destination for the arts in mid-Wales. As part of Aberystwyth University, it is widely recognised as a national flagship for the arts, offering a diverse programme of exhibitions, performances, workshops and community activities.

The centre offers a rich variety of artistic events, from live music concerts across genres and theatre productions by local and international performers to thought-provoking art exhibitions featuring both established and emerging artists. Diverse film screenings showcase independent films, documentaries, and popular releases, creating a vibrant hub for audiences of all interests.

Love lighting, sound, or stage management?Aberystwyth Arts Centre is offering a paid 12-month Theatre Technical Apprenticeship in partnership with Wales Millennium Centre! Get hands-on experience, professional training & industry-recognised qualifications. Our past apprentices have gone on to major tours, venues & freelance work.✨Based in Aberystwyth✨Level 3 Certificate + ABTT Bronze Award ✨Full-time (evenings/weekends)✨£13,741Closing date: 9th JulyMore information and how to apply link in bio ... Bydd mwy o wybodaeth am y perfformiadau yn y Sam Wanamaker Playhouse yn cael ei gyhoeddi cyn hir.Mae rhagor o wybodaeth ar ein gwefan: theatr.cymru/newyddion/romeo-a-juliet-steffan-cennydd-ac-annes-elwy-mewn-cynhyrchiad-dwyieithog-s...---We’re proud to announce that we’re working in association with Shakespeare's Globe to present a bilingual production of William Shakespeare’s Romeo a Juliet. The production will tour venues across Wales in the autumn ahead of a limited run at the Globe’s Sam Wanamaker Playhouse in London.Directed by Theatr Cymru’s Artistic Director, Steffan Donnelly, the production stars Steffan Cennydd as Romeo and Annes Elwy as Juliet – two powerhouse performers bringing their talent and experience to the roles of the famous tragic couple.Two families, two languages and a young couple who are prepared to risk it all...Tickets on sale soon at Sherman Theatre, Theatr Brycheiniog, Canolfan y Celfyddydau Aberystwyth Arts Centre, Pontio Bangor Theatr Clwyd and Ffwrnes.
